Error Code 81
The compressor won't start up
Critical
Stop using immediately - risk of damage or safety issue
Also displayed as: 81
What This Means
Inverter PCB soldering defect or cold solder joints; Short circuit in inverter power stage; DC voltage output less than 13.5V; Compressor motor defective or locked; Refrigerant cycle failure
What actually causes this:
The compressor motor is locked, the inverter is broken, or there's a power delivery problem
First Thing to Check
Turn off the refrigerator, wait 5 minutes, and turn it back on to reset the compressor
Parts Involved
How to Fix
- 1
1. Check soldering status of inverter PCB for cold solder joints
- 2
2. Check for any short-circuited components on inverter
- 3
3. Measure DC 16V output from inverter — normal: 13.5V or higher
- 4
4. Verify compressor winding is not shorted or open
- 5
5. Check refrigerant cycle for blockage
